Online News Sources:
AllSides: AllSides is a media technology company that provides balanced news coverage and assigns media bias ratings to over 800 news outlets, helping users identify perspectives from the left, center, and right to avoid partisan bias. It offers a media bias chart rating sources as Left, Lean Left, Center, Lean Right, or Right, aiming to combat the "hidden" bias that divides consumers.
Ground.News: Ground News is a Canadian news aggregator and media literacy platform that helps readers compare how different news outlets report the same story, highlighting media bias and political blind spots. It provides tools to see the political leaning (Left, Right, or Center) of sources, fostering a more balanced perspective. Sometimes the website crashes so be patient.
